1. Jinzi Park

Located in Jinci Town, Jinyuan District, Taiyuan City, Shanxi Province, Jinci Park is one of the longest-existing classical clan garden complexes in China’s history. Built in the Northern Wei Dynasty, with most of the buildings expanded and remodeled during the Song, Yuan, Ming and Qing Dynasties, the Jin Ancestral Temple is one of the oldest royal gardens in China, and an important place for the study of ancient Chinese history, culture and art. Inside the Jin Ancestral Temple, ancient trees and blue water surround the temple, and a stroll through it is like traveling through a thousand years.

2. Shanxi Museum

Located at No. 13, North of Binhe West Road, Taiyuan, Shanxi Museum is a national-level museum covering an area of 168 acres, with a building area of 5.2 million square meters and a large collection of precious relics. The exhibits in the museum cover a wide range of categories, including bronzes, porcelains, stone carvings, Buddha statues, murals and calligraphic works, enabling the public to better understand the history and artistic heritage of Shanxi.

3. Taiyuan Ancient County Town

The ancient county town of Taiyuan, known as the “Phoenix City” since ancient times, was the county town in the early Ming Dynasty, following the ancient architectural pattern of the ancient city of Jinyang, “the city pool Fengxiang Yu”, like a phoenix with its head to the north and tail to the south. The ancient county town was built in Ming Dynasty Hongwu eight years, the city now has many historical building remains, and the cross-street pattern is clear, is the continuation of the 2500 years of Jinyang Ancient City culture. There are 79 existing cultural relics and buildings in the city, and 49 historical buildings are listed for protection by the Taiyuan Municipal Government, among which the Temple of Literature is listed as a national key cultural relics protection unit.

4. Shuangta Temple Scenic Spot

Double Pagoda Temple Scenic Spot is located in the southeast of Taiyuan City, Shanxi Province, Haozhuang Village, south of the foot of the mountain, because the temple has two towers and named. Shuangta Temple was built in the middle of the Wanli Period of the Ming Dynasty, and is a very famous scenic spot in Shanxi Province and even in the country. The two towers in the temple, towering and imposing, are one of the landmarks of Taiyuan.

6. Mengshan Big Buddha Tourist Area

Mengshan Giant Buddha, also known as Jinyang Xishan Giant Buddha, was built in the Tianbao period of the Northern Qi Dynasty, about 1,500 years ago, and is a famous Buddhist mountain. Built on the mountain, the Great Buddha is majestic and breathtaking. Mengshan Buddha is not only a scenic spot in Taiyuan, but also a treasure house of ancient Chinese stone carving art.

7. Fenhe Scenic Spot in Taiyuan

Fen River Scenic Spot is an important urban river and lake scenic spot in Taiyuan, which has greatly improved the water quality and landscape of the Fen River through pollution control, pollution interception, siltation, bank protection, greening, water transfer and other measures. With a total length of about 6 kilometers and an area of more than 300 acres, the scenic area is a good place for leisure and walking.


8. Horowai Mountain Scenic Area

Horiwei Mountain Scenic Spot is located in Taiyuan City, with high and steep mountains, dense forests and many ancient monuments, and “Horiwei Red Leaves” is one of the eight ancient scenic spots in Taiyuan in the fall. Horiwei Mountain not only attracts many tourists with its beautiful natural scenery, but is also famous for its rich historical and cultural connotations.

9. Taiyuan Botanical Garden

Taiyuan Botanical Garden, located in Jinyuan District at the intersection of Jinyang Avenue and Jinyuan Street in Jinyuan District, is a comprehensive botanical garden in Shanxi Province that integrates scientific research, popularization of science and education, horticultural viewing and cultural tourism. The botanical garden has three major theme pavilions, including the Flower Pavilion, Rainforest Pavilion and Sand Plant Pavilion, which display rare plants and flowers from all over the world.

10. China Coal Museum

Located at the intersection of Yingze Street and Jinzi Road in Taiyuan, China Coal Museum is the only national-level coal museum in China. The museum houses a large collection of coal-related cultural relics and exhibits, showcasing the history and development of China’s coal industry.
